Problem Solving Final Draft

The first problem solving artifact is a Varicella IDP that was completed in Fall of 2016.

In this IDP I was assigned to research Varicella, make a children's book, come up with a call to

action, and present this information to a panel of health professionals. This assignment fits into

the problem solving category because my group and I came up with a solution to a problem

affecting the community. What I learned from this assignment was about ways to prevent

Varicella.

The second problem solving artifact is a Lead Toxicity IDP that was completed in Spring

of 2019. On this assignment I was asked to research lead toxicity in our area and also collect data

on the levels of lead toxicity in the soil gathered from homes in Huntington Park. I was also

asked to plant two plants, one using home soil and another using organic soil. After this, we

came up with a call to action that my group and I presented to a panel of health professionals.

This IDP fits into the problem solving category because we came up with a solution to a problem

in our community, as well as solved a problem occurring in our group that did not let us work to

our full potential. I learned from this assignment that communication within the group is very

important.

Student Led Outcomes that I demonstrated while doing both these IDPs were being a

critical thinker and an effective communicator. I demonstrated being a critical thinker by

identifying the problem with toxicity, thinking of a solution to lead toxicity issues in our area,

and also analyzing the lab results of the soil collected from homes. I also demonstrated being an
effective communicators by making sure the audience had a full understanding of what I was

saying, presenting in front of health professionals to raise awareness, and also communicating

with each other in our group about our group roles. Some areas of growth I have seen within

myself are better presentation skills, a better understanding of the SLOs, and having courage to

present in front of a panel. Some areas I still need to improve on are being able to memorize

bigger parts of a presentation, and also be prepared for any questions I am asked. I can use these

skills in the future by presenting to a group of people about an important issue without having a

problem. I can also work in a group in the future and communicate when working a job that

requires a group effort.
